M. R. Stefanik Airport (BTS)
M. R. Stefanik Airport (BTS) currently has nonstop service to 81 destinations on 22 airlines in our latest departure data. The busiest route is to Antalya (AYT), served by 6 carriers, and the largest operator here is Ryanair with nonstops to 33 destinations. 80 of its routes are international.
Route data as of June 15, 2026, based on a 7-day departures sample.
